The 2024 UNEP report expressed considerable hope that countries could use economic stimulus efforts … Web25 nov. 2014 · For the energy sector, the world average is 372 tonnes of greenhouse gas emissions (CO2e) per Million $GDP, but intensities vary across countries. Seven of the top 10 emitters actually have a below average emissions intensity; Russia, China and Canada are above the world average.
